Default 2007 Ford Focus 2.0 issues

Hi

Recently on cold mornings, my Focus has developed a ticking noise, as well as vibrations/knocking within the Engine Bay audible from the right hand side...

After covering a couple of miles(5-10 mins later). The vibration sound stops.

Also repeat starting this Motor can be a pain, it'll turn over and over, until the point it gives in, which then leaves a check engine light, the only way to get the Car going when it behaves like this is to push the accelerator whilst turning over...

Any idea's these issues may be?

So a local garage had a closer look today, and said the vibration/knocking, was down to the water pump and drive belt tensioner. Replacing these parts and some fresh engine coolant, left me £218 out of pocket. For parts and Labour is this excessive? My Dad reckons not as main stealer prices may charge 2.5-3x more....

The starting issue isn't said to be an engine fault from what the diagnostic system reports...more the Alternator to blame and was noted the Alternator Drive Pulley is somewhat noisy. And the Radiator could be leaking

All these issues on a soon to be 6 year old Car with 36k on the clock is a bit poor surely?
